Tire stress, measured in kilos per sq. inch (psi), is an important issue influencing the efficiency and security of street bicycles designed for paved surfaces. The proper inflation stress is determined by a mix of things, together with tire dimension, rider weight, and using circumstances. For instance, a bigger quantity tire usually requires decrease stress than a narrower tire. Equally, a heavier rider will want greater stress than a lighter rider utilizing the identical tires. Street circumstances additionally play a task; rougher surfaces could profit from barely decrease stress for elevated consolation and grip, whereas easy surfaces permit for greater pressures to reduce rolling resistance.
Sustaining optimum tire stress supplies a number of key advantages. Correct inflation ensures optimum contact with the street floor, enhancing dealing with, cornering grip, and braking effectivity. It additionally minimizes rolling resistance, resulting in elevated velocity and lowered pedaling effort. Moreover, appropriate stress helps stop pinch flats (attributable to the tire pinching towards the rim upon affect) and untimely tire put on. Traditionally, riders usually relied on really feel or rudimentary gauges, however trendy expertise gives exact digital gauges and even tire stress monitoring programs for enhanced accuracy and comfort.
